Are Plastic Bottle Lids Recyclable Australia. Lids4kids rescues plastic bottle lids from landfill and recycles them to protect our environment for future generations and wildlife. Here is a list of australian councils and what they accept in kerbside recycling. The issue with plastic bottle lids represents a broader issue with australia's recycling capabilities, the sector says. There is conflicting information about which plastics can be recycled in kerbside collection, and sometimes it can depend on the state or council area you or your business are in. Lids4kids, please note they don’t accept plastic lids with rubber inside. Well, this may be easy enough for the main bottle component, but plastic lids don’t fit as easily into the general recycling equation. Small plastic items like bottle lids can be recycled, but individually may slip through recycling machines, so put them into a larger plastic bottle before adding them to your.
